Is There a Curious Mind in Adults?

There's a lot of curiosity in adults. And I don't know that we have good evidence for it decreasing over time. The space of like possible things you could be interested in is so big, it makes sense to give priority to the things about which you have some background. So as we get older and we accumulate more knowledge, it could be that the intensity is the same. It could even be that it's stronger.
